PENGARUH MUSIK KECAPI SULING " AYUN AMBING " TERHADAP LAJU ALIR SALIVA
Background: Hyposalivation can have negative impacts on oral health such as increasing the risk of oral candidiasis and caries, so the salivary flow rate needs to be increased by using auditory stimuli such as music. The kecapi suling "Ayun Ambing" music is traditional music originating from the province of West Java, it has a calm, slow and relaxed tone, but its effect on salivary flow rate has never been studied. This study aims determine to the effect of kecapi suling "Ayun Ambing" music on salivary flow rate. Method: This study used a pre-experimental study with a post-test only design approach involving 20 students of Dentistry Program Faculty of Medicine Sriwijaya University aged 19-23 years. Saliva will be collected before listening to music with the spitting method for 5 minutes every 60 seconds. Subjects were given the kecapi suling "Ayun Ambing" music stimulus for 15 minutes then saliva was collected in the last 5 minutes every 60 seconds.The collected saliva was recorded as the value of saliva flow rate in g/minute. Data were analyzed using the Saphiro-Wilk test and paired T test.
